Helicopter is the best and quickest way to get to mountain destinations and Base Camps. A helicopter ride to EVEREST BASE CAMP is one of the most coveted and memorable ride. This one three hour trip (two hour turnaround flight, 10 minutes at Kalapatthar and 45 minutes at the Everest View Hotel with Everest Valley Backdrop) can be a trip to compensate a trip to space.
5:30-6:30 am: Hotel to airport
Everest helicopter tour begins from Tribhuwan International Airport, Kathmandu. In the early morning, we will transfer you to the domestic terminal of the airport from the hotel.
6:30-7:00 am: Preparation to take scheduled helicopter flight
Your guide will assist you to complete all the necessary preparations including check-in and security procedures. Make sure you have all the required documents and board in the helicopter to fly.
7:00-8:00 am: Fly to Lukla
After you complete airport formalities you will proceed to fly Lukla. Embark on a scenic helicopter flight from Kathmandu to Lukla. Enjoy panoramic views of the Himalayan mountain range and the stunning landscapes below.
8:00-8:15 am: Refueling
You will begin to experience local Sherpa culture and way of life as soon as you arrive in Lukla. There are a lot of Sherpa porters and tour guides at the airport waiting for their customers. The flight's refueling process will take roughly 15 minutes ensuring a safe and uninterrupted journey.
8:15-8:30 am: Fly to Kala Pattar
You'll catch a flight to Kala Pattar in the morning. Near Mount Everest, there is a well-known lookout point called Kala Pattar that provides breathtaking panoramas of the Himalayas. Depending on where you take off, the flight time may vary, but you could expect to arrive at Kala Pattar in around 15 minutes on average.
8:30-8:45 am: Land and explore Kala Pattar
You will have a little window of time to explore the region after arriving at Kala Pattar. Awe-inspiring views of Mount Everest, as well as other notable peaks like Nuptse and Lhotse, can be found at Kala Pattar. Spend some time admiring the breathtaking view and taking pictures.
8:45-9:00 am: Fly to Syangboche
Once you've had a chance to explore Kala Pattar, you'll take off for Syangboche. In the Everest region, at a height of around 3,800 meters, is a tiny settlement called Syangboche. Usually, it takes 15 minutes to fly from Kala Pattar to Syangboche.
9:00-9:30 am: Breakfast at Everest View Hotel
You will proceed to the famed Everest View Hotel for breakfast after you arrive in Syangboche. At a height of about 3,880 meters, the hotel offers stunning views of Mount Everest and the peaks that surround it. Enjoy a sumptuous breakfast while admiring the magnificent surroundings.
9:30-10:00 am: Fly to Lukla and refueling
You will take a different flight, this one to Lukla, after breakfast. A little hamlet called Lukla serves as the entrance to the Everest region. Normally, the flight from Syangboche to Lukla lasts for around 30 minutes. The airplane will refuel upon arrival in order to get ready for the following part of the flight.
10:00-11:00 am: Fly from Lukla to Kathmandu
You will take a flight from Lukla to Nepal's capital city of Kathmandu. From Lukla to Kathmandu, the flight takes around an hour. Your journey across the Everest region will come to an end once you arrive in Kathmandu, where you may either stay and explore the exciting city or go on to your next location.
